Description
In the world of antiquity and collecting, how do experts identify the subtle (or glaring!) difference between authenticity and forgery? In this tour, we’ll explore this question with a wide range of objects in the Rosenbach’s collection. We’ll look at some of Shakespeare’s greatest works, a mug that once belonged to George Washington, a manuscript draft by Edgar Allan Poe, and in this special edition of the popular Fakes & Forgeries tour, we will spend additional time examining several Shakespeare forgeries by William Henry Ireland.
About Behind the Bookcase: Hands-on Tours at The Rosenbach
Behind the Bookcase: Hands-on Tours offer unparalleled access to see, and even touch, rare and important items not usually on view to the public. Each program is dedicated to a different author, theme, or topic and grants a truly hands-on experience with materials in The Rosenbach’s inspiring collection.
